Phone number ☎️ 01274736968 👆 is reported as a scam where a recorded message claims to be from a government agency, warning the receiver to press a number or face arrest. Users describe it as a threatening and deceptive call aimed to alarm and trick people. The tone is aggressive, and it appears designed to cause panic rather than provide any genuine information. Many have flagged it as suspicious and advise caution when receiving such messages.

About 01 Numbers

These digits are linked with specific locations in the UK and are frequently used by homes and businesses. Also known as as 'basic rate', 'local rate', or 'national rate' numbers, the charges for these geographic numbers are predicated on the time of day. Many service providers offer call packages that offer free calls during particular times. Call costs from mobile phones are according to the chosen calling plan, with many plans providing these numbers in their free call packages.
